WatchNavy Survivors' Certificates
A typical pension includes the application and original jacket; a brief of the case prepared by the Pension Bureau; a statement of the service record supplied by the Navy Department; affidavits, and other documentary evidence submitted in support of the claim; correspondence from interested persons; and occasionally a certificate of discharge, a death certificate, and papers relating to claims for burial expenses. Source Information
Case Files of Approved Pension Applications of Civil War and Later Navy Veterans (Navy Survivors' Certificates), 1861-1910. Original data from: The National Archives
